Fortaleza kept breaking records and finished 4th, in 2024, with more points collected than in any other season on the club's history. Besides, they reached quarter-finals in Sul-Americana. Fortaleza has achieved the final of Campeonato Cearense, as it is their obligation, but failed to beat their arch-rivals Ceará in the final. Manager Juan Pablo Vojvoda is, these days, the club's biggest icon. He has been on the job since 2021 and has became an institution within the club. His ability to reinvent the team's tactics in slower periods is second to none. For 2025, Fortaleza had minimal changes. David Luiz is a big name signed for the back, but it's questionable on whether the former Brazilian international will add anything significant, now that he is 37 and had a poor season with Flamengo, in 2024. Centre-back Avila, left-back Diogo Barbosa and especially Pol Fernandez in midfield are definite improvements on the team that only saw sometimes starting Cardona, injury-prone Hércules and reserve winger Machuca leaving. Pol Fernandez is indeed a statement-signing, as Fortaleza managed to bring a first team option from Boca Juniors, something unimaginable a couple of years ago. Lucero, at 33, still looks fresh and thirsty for more goals. Wingers Moisés, Pikachu, Marinho and Breno Lopes are excellent partners that will rotate to support the Argentinean in attack. There are multiple options in midfield that should live around the new reference Pol Fernandez. At the back, the options are the same as last year plus Luiz, Avila and Barbosa. The latter looks the likeliest to become an instat first team option.

Target


Repeating the success of recent seasons and establish Fortaleza as a force in the country, rather than a short-lived phenomenon.
